The World Record Of Fastest To Count From 10 To 1 By A Toddler (Reverse Counting) Is Achieved By Aadhidev Vignesh Kumar On 10 February 2024 In Chennai, Tamil Nadu, India. He Recited Numbers From 10 To 1 In 5 Seconds At The Age Of 1 Year 8 Months 26 Days And Has Set A World Record For The Worldwide Book Of Records.
